Make the rough opening 3″ wider than the garage door. Also, make the rough opening 1.5″ taller than the garage door. Leave a headroom of 14″, or 12″ minimum. Install the header, jambs and center pad of the frame using a 2″ x 6″ lumber for the header, jambs and center pad. Leave at least 5″ of space on the sides of the door.Use a Tape Measure: Measure the width and height of the framed opening in the wall where the door will be installed. Take multiple measurements to ensure accuracy. Account for Clearances: Consider the required headroom, side room, and backroom clearances when determining the rough opening size. Store SO SKU # 1000242072. Additional Resources river that moses turned to blood crossword clue Garage Door Framing Tips. Install side and head jambs after the wall is in place. Leave side jambs 1/4" off concrete floor to prevent moisture wicking and rot. If using 1 x material for side and head jambs, reduce header length and height accordingly.
